Commercial Description:
Traditional American amber lager with distinct hop flavor.

Bottled. Pours a golden amber with an off-white head that quickly settles down to a lacy ring. Floral hop aroma with citrus and caramel behind it. The body is light-ish with light carbonation. The taste starts sweet with malty toffee and mango notes. Crisp, quick, slightly piney finish. Well rounded, hugely sessionable.

Light amber resin color w. slim carbonation/. Moderate, but pleasant pilsneresque carbonation from saaz? hops. Slight malt presence. Clean, crisp finish reminiscent of Yuengling Lager. Perilously drinkable--what a lager should be.
